Least Common Multiple of 37681 and 37701 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 37681 and 37701,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(37681,37701) = 1
LCM(37681,37701) = ( 37681 × 37701) / 1
LCM(37681,37701) = 1420611381 / 1
LCM(37681,37701) = 1420611381
